Meeting notes – Cooler logistics, Tarn Hollow clinic

Attendees agreed the vaccine cooler leaves the Brightmere depot at 06:00 with Arrowline Medical Couriers. Receiving site must check the temperature strip on arrival and log it before opening. Ice packs to be swapped only by clinic staff. The confidential hand-over instruction for the courier follows below.

handover note for yagef-bagep: the drudor pelius courier leaves the kasdor zorvan norir ledger at gate 8016 under passcode 755406

## Formula sandbox tuning

User-supplied formulas in Gridmoor execute inside a restricted interpreter with hard ceilings on time, memory, and call depth. Reviewers should confirm any change to these ceilings is justified in the PR description, since raising them widens the abuse surface. Defaults were chosen from production traces. The current limits are as follows.

limits module of tafog-fawip:
WEIGHTS = {
    "julix": 57,
    "lamys": 992,
    "kasvan": 209,
    "quenok": 750,
    "alddor": 259,
    "oliath": 1009,
    "wenix": 815,
}

Memo to Finance Team — Inventory Write-Down

Quick heads-up: we're taking a write-down on the remaining Fenwick-series enclosures sitting in the Dunmore warehouse. Demand never recovered after the Atlas line launch, and the units are now two revisions behind. Expect roughly an 18% hit to that stock category in this quarter's books. Please flag the adjustment in the monthly close package and route questions to Priya on the controls side. The reasoning ties into the confidential note below.

board note of bawep-tajef: Queniusek Systems plans to raise the Quenvan list price by 53.1 percent in March. The pricing group signed off on a budget of $176.4 million for Project Drueth. The renewal with Casionix Partners closes at $142.5 million a year, 8.3 percent below the last contract. Project Fraax slips by six weeks because of the tooling delay.